Bass on Top is another thoroughly engaging set of straight-ahead, mainstream jazz from Paul Chambers. The bassist leads a quartet comprised of guitarist Kenny Burrell, pianist Hank Jones, and drummer Art Taylor through a selection of standards, including "Yesterdays," "You'd Be So Nice to Come Home To," and "Dear Old Stockholm," as well as a handful of contemporary jazz numbers and originals. There's a relaxed, friendly atmosphere to the music, both in its tone and in the fact that Chambers lets Jones and Burrell have some time in the spotlight. The result is a warm, entertaining collection of mainstream jazz that nevertheless rewards close listening.

Tracks:

01. Yesterdays (Kern-Harbach) - 5:56
02. You'd Be So Nice to Come Home To (Porter) - 7:19
03. Chasin' the Bird (Parker) - 6:18
04. Dear Old Stockholm (Trad.) - 6:46
05. The Theme (Davis) - 6:16
06. Confessin' (Daugherty-Reynolds-Neiburg) - 4:14
07. Chamber Mates (Chambers-Burrell) - 5:03

Personnel:

Kenny Burrell - guitar
Hank Jones - piano
Paul Chambers - bass
Art Taylor - drums
